Why it stands out
The 2020 GMC Sierra 2500HD distinguishes itself with a robust performance profile, featuring both gasoline and diesel V8 engine options, which cater to a range of towing needs with maximum capabilities that impress even the most demanding buyers. The Denali trim, in particular, elevates the luxury experience through high-quality interiors paired with advanced technology, although some reviewers have pointed out that it doesn't quite meet luxury standards compared to its competitors. The truck boasts a variety of modern safety features, making it suitable for various driving conditions. Despite its heavy-duty stature, which can be cumbersome in tight spaces, it remains an all-around appealing choice for those in need of both capability and comfort.

Who Makes GMC Cars?
GMC is an American automaker that builds premium trucks and SUVs with capability and comfort as selling points. GMC is a division of General Motors and all of its vehicles share platforms with other GM products. Certain products, like its trucks, are very closely related to Chevrolet products.

2020 GMC Sierra 2500HD Trims
| Trim type | MSRP |
|---|---|
| Base LB 4WD | $38,600 |
| Denali Crew Cab LB 4WD | $64,500 |
| SLT Double Cab 4WD | $53,800 |
| Base Crew Cab 4WD | $43,000 |
| SLE Crew Cab 4WD | $44,400 |
| SLT Crew Cab 4WD | $55,600 |
| AT4 Crew Cab 4WD | $58,300 |
| Denali Crew Cab 4WD | $64,300 |
